Abstract
The traditional method of analyzing and retrieving student results is laborious and stressful, involving manual tools like books and pencils. This project focuses on developing an automated student result processing system to streamline this process, emphasizing its importance over manual methods. This system allows easy insertion and deletion of student records, updating them following continuous assessment and examination. With security measures, it reduces instances of missing records. Result processing officers are assigned passwords for accessing and managing student data, ensuring confidentiality. Overall, it resolves issues associated with manual result processing, offering efficiency and accuracy
